AI-Driven Team Coordination and Balance Systems
One of the most important uses of AI in multiplayer games is team balancing. AI analyzes player skill, experience, and performance history to create evenly matched teams.
AI also improves in-game coordination by analyzing team behavior and suggesting strategies or adjustments. Some systems even provide real-time tactical recommendations during matches.
A key concept behind this system is swarm intelligence. In gaming, swarm intelligence refers to AI systems that mimic collective behavior, similar to how groups of animals or agents work together in nature.
AI is also used in matchmaking systems. It ensures players are paired with others of similar skill levels, reducing frustration and improving competitiveness.
Another important feature is behavior monitoring. AI detects toxic behavior, unfair play, or disruptive actions and applies moderation systems automatically.
However, multiplayer AI must be carefully designed to avoid bias or unfair matchmaking outcomes.
